PHPcms首页分页实现技巧,提升用户体验

在现代互联网时代,网站的用户体验越来越受到重视。而对于一个内容丰富的网站来说,首页分页是提升用户体验的重要一环。我们将介绍PHPcms首页分页的实现技巧,帮助网站管理员提升用户体验。

让我们来了解一下PHPcms。PHPcms是一种基于PHP语言开发的内容管理系统,它具有强大的功能和灵活的扩展性,被广泛应用于各种类型的网站。其中,首页分页是PHPcms的一个重要功能,它可以将网站的内容分成多个页面,使用户可以方便地浏览和查找感兴趣的内容。

接下来,我们将详细阐述PHPcms首页分页的实现技巧,从以下8个方面进行介绍:

1. 分页的基本原理

2. 设置每页显示的内容数量

3. 显示分页导航

4. 处理分页参数

5. 数据库查询优化

6. 缓存分页数据

7. SEO优化

8. 用户体验优化

1. 分页的基本原理

在PHPcms中,分页的基本原理是通过计算总页数和当前页码来实现的。通过获取总记录数和每页显示的记录数,可以计算出总页数。然后,根据当前页码来查询数据库中对应的记录,并将其显示在页面上。

2. 设置每页显示的内容数量

为了提供更好的用户体验,我们可以根据网站的需求来设置每页显示的内容数量。通常情况下,每页显示10到20条内容是比较合适的。

3. 显示分页导航

为了方便用户浏览和切换页面,我们可以在页面底部显示分页导航。通过使用HTML和CSS来设计分页导航的样式,并使用PHP代码来生成分页导航的链接。

4. 处理分页参数

在PHPcms中,我们可以通过$_GET或$_POST来获取分页参数。然后,根据分页参数来查询数据库中对应的记录,并将其显示在页面上。

5. 数据库查询优化

为了提高网站的性能,我们可以对数据库查询进行优化。可以使用索引来加快查询速度,避免全表扫描。可以使用分页查询语句来减少查询的数据量,提高查询效率。

6. 缓存分页数据

为了进一步提高网站的性能,我们可以使用缓存来存储分页数据。可以使用Memcached或Redis等缓存技术来存储查询结果,减少数据库的访问次数,提高网站的响应速度。

7. SEO优化

为了提高网站的搜索引擎排名,我们可以对分页链接进行优化。可以使用有意义的URL来代替动态URL,使用关键词来描述分页内容,提高搜索引擎的收录率。

8. 用户体验优化

为了提升用户体验,我们可以在分页导航中添加一些额外的功能。例如,可以添加上一页和下一页的链接,方便用户在不同页面之间进行切换。可以添加快速跳转功能,让用户可以直接跳转到指定的页面。

通过以上8个方面的详细阐述,我们可以看出,PHPcms首页分页的实现技巧是多方面的。通过合理设置每页显示的内容数量、显示分页导航、处理分页参数、数据库查询优化、缓存分页数据、SEO优化和用户体验优化等方法,可以提升用户体验,让用户更加方便地浏览和查找感兴趣的内容。

PHPcms首页分页是提升用户体验的重要一环。通过合理设置每页显示的内容数量、显示分页导航、处理分页参数、数据库查询优化、缓存分页数据、SEO优化和用户体验优化等技巧,可以提升用户体验,让用户更加方便地浏览和查找感兴趣的内容。希望本文能够帮助网站管理员更好地实现PHPcms首页分页功能,提升用户体验。